"A place that draws on Kanazawa's traditions" During the Edo period, this area flourished as the domain of Kaga Hyakumangoku, and diverse cultures were encouraged. Master craftsmen and cultural figures from all over the country were invited to this town, and a unique samurai culture flourished. These values and aesthetic sense are still passed down in people's lives today as tea ceremony, Noh, Zen, and architecture. Hanaakari is a modern Japanese designer hotel with a theme of the traditional colors of Kaga. Traditional Kaga crafts such as Kaga Yuzen, Kaga Gosai, Kaga Temari, Kaga Stitching, and Kaga Mizuhiki are featured throughout the hotel and guest rooms, providing a travel space that is unique to Kanazawa. All five rooms are divided into five colors based on the traditional Kaga colors of "Kaga Gosai" - "Ocher", "Ancient Purple", "Grass", "Crimson" and "Indigo" - and you can feel the essence of Kanazawa from the rooms decorated with traditional crafts.

■About the rooms The "Ume no Ma" room where you will be staying was built in 1965. The walls are a vibrant yet calm color typical of Kanazawa, and have been used for the exterior and interior walls of buildings since ancient times. The room consists of an 8-tatami main room, a 6-tatami next room, a tatami corridor, and a 4.5-tatami waiting room. The bedding for your sleep is an Airweave mattress with a down comforter. The bathroom has a cypress-scented bathtub where you can relax and enjoy a bath. The guest room amenities include cosmetics containing gold leaf, which is unique to Kanazawa. Dinner and breakfast are served in a separate detached building called "Ochin". For dinner, you will enjoy Kaga kaiseki cuisine. We will arrange various dishes according to the season based on the basic composition of appetizers, appetizers, sashimi, takiawase, grilled dishes, main dishes, vinegared dishes, rice, and fruit. We can also include jibuni and steamed lotus, which are representative of Kaga cuisine, upon request. We also offer a variety of local sake from famous sake breweries in the prefecture. Breakfast is based on rice cooked in a clay pot, miso soup, kuchitori, grilled dishes, simmered dishes, and other dishes, with seasonal dishes such as boiled tofu also available.
■About Hoshi - The oldest inn in the Hokuriku region The history of Hoshi began at the same time as the history of Mt. Hakusan, one of Japan's three most sacred mountains, which celebrated its 1,300th anniversary since its founding. While Taicho Daishi was undergoing rigorous training at Mt. Hakusan, Hakusan Daigongen appeared in a dream and told him about a sacred spring hidden deep underground. Following the god's words, Daishi went to Awazu and discovered the sacred spring. He had his disciple, Masaaki, who had been close to him, build a hot spring inn and entrusted it with the care of the hot spring, and this was the beginning of "Hoshi". After Masaaki's death, his adopted son Zengoro took over as the second generation, and the inn has continued to be run by the same family for 46 generations, and continues to protect the hot spring to this day. It is a rare inn in the world that has continued to operate solely by the family.
